Zusammenfassung:This paper aims to understand Heisenberg vertex algebras in terms of their semi-conformal structures. First, we study the moduli space of conformal and semi-conformal structures on Heisenberg vertex algebras that have the standard fixed conformal gradation by describing their automorphism groups. We describe its semi-conformal vectors as pairs consisting of regular subspaces and the projections of a fixed vector space in these regular subspaces. Then by automorphism groups G of Heisenberg vertex operator algebras, we get all G-orbits of varieties of their semi-conformal vectors and give some characterizations of Heisenberg vertex operator algebras.
